Christie tomará su decisión individualmente

Josh Margolin cuenta en el New York Post que el Gobernador Christie ha dejado de escuchar a sus asesores y está en la fase de decidir por sí mismo:
Christie remained largely out of sight yesterday, working at his office at the State House in Trenton and attending a late-afternoon judicial swearing-in in Paterson. Again, he took no questions from the press.

The governor has all but shut down communications with his advisers -- even his inner circle -- telling them he had already gathered all the information he needs to make his decision. The only thing left is for him to come to a decision in his own mind.

As of late yesterday, Christie’s pals said there was no way to handicap which way the governor was leaning because he has told no one where he’s headed.

Those who have been involved in the discussions say the accelerated primary calendar is a daunting obstacle.
